0

GA 管理ページで、セクションをチェックして、Use enhanced link attributionGoogle アナリティクスの拡張リンク属性を有効にする必要があります。

しかし、コードはどのように見えますか? 機能が新しくても、多くの情報源は古いようです。Googleがドキュメントページで公開しているコードは正確で完全ですか、それとも別のものであるべきですか?

var _gaq = _gaq || [];
var pluginUrl = 
 '//www.google-analytics.com/plugins/ga/inpage_linkid.js';
_gaq.push(['_require', 'inpage_linkid', pluginUrl]);
_gaq.push(['_setAccount', 'UA-XXXXXX-Y']);
_gaq.push(['_trackPageview']);
4

1 に答える 1

0

はい、正しいです。私の完全なコードは次のようになります

var _gaq = _gaq || [];
      var pluginUrl ='//www.google-analytics.com/plugins/ga/inpage_linkid.js';
      _gaq.push(['_require', 'inpage_linkid', pluginUrl]);
      _gaq.push(['_setAccount', 'UA-xxxxxxxx-1']);
      _gaq.push(['_setDomainName', 'domainname.com']);
      _gaq.push(['_setAllowAnchor',true]);
      _gaq.push(['_setCustomVar',5,'CusVarName','CusVarNameValue',3]);
      _gaq.push(['_trackPageview']);
(function() {
      var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
      ga.src = ('https:' == document.location.protocol ? 'https://' : 'http://') + 'stats.g.doubleclick.net/dc.js';
      var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
      })();

しかし、セットアップが基本的で、上記の例に従っている場合は、問題なく動作するはずです。setAccount の上に pluginUrl 変数を追加する限り、機能するはずです。

于 2013-09-23T03:34:24.397 に答える